Installation Clear CMOS (JPlZ) BIOS setting values and password are stored in CMOS RAM. To clear CMOS Data of your computer, please open the computer chassis;short Z-3 of JP12 with shori jumper during l-2 seconds, then CMOS data will 2-3 : Max. (Default) be cleared.

Built-h BIOS Setup Program After making all modifications in the SETUP program, go to the option “Save & Exit SETUP” then press the <Enter> key. The program will display the following screen. Press <Y> to confirm the changes made, and the <N> or the &so keys if further modifications are sill necessary before exitiong the SETUP program.
